Diverse wood species in custom cabinetry

Grasping common wood species is vital when considering Custom Woodwork Cabinetry. Diverse woods present distinct aesthetics, durability, and workability for custom built cabinetry. For homeowners seeking lasting beauty in their Custom Woodwork Cabinetry, choices like maple, cherry, and white oak are frequently utilized by cabinet makers for their robust nature and pleasing grain patterns.

Professionals crafting Custom Woodwork Cabinetry often select wood based on a project's definite demands. Maple provides a smooth, even finish perfect for painted custom wood cabinets, while cherry darkens beautifully with age, offering rich, warm tones for bespoke woodwork. White oak, known for its power and prominent grain, is a popular choice for rustic or contemporary Custom Woodwork Cabinetry. These high materials certify the longevity and refined appearance of handcrafted cabinets, showing true artisan cabinetry in every piece.

Uncover finishing selections for custom wood cabinet

The ultimate touch in Custom Woodwork Cabinetry involves a varied array of finishing choices, each design to shield the wood and enhance its aesthetic appeal. Choosing the correct finish is vital for the durability and visual influence of your Custom Woodwork Cabinetry, particularly when reviewing kitchen design and remodeling. From durable lacquers and varnishes that provide a strong layer, to stains that emphasize the natural grain, the selections directly affect the overall design and layout.

For Custom Woodwork Cabinetry, painted finishes provide a extensive spectrum of colors, allowing for exact integration with any interior design scheme or custom storage needs. Glazes can add fullness and character, providing an antique or distressed appearance to Custom Woodwork Cabinetry, perfectly suiting specific architectural styles. Natural oil finishes penetrate the wood, supplying a more delicate, matte finish that emphasizes the innate elegance of the timber, suitable for those designing cabinets with a minimalist aesthetic.

How architectural design influence cabinetry

Architectural styles deeply impact Custom Woodwork Cabinetry design, making seamless integration with a home's overall appearance. For instance, Craftsman-style homes often include Custom Woodwork Cabinetry with basic lines, exposed joinery, and natural wood finishes, stressing artisan woodwork and durability. Conversely, a Victorian-era residence might prompt more fancy Custom Woodwork Cabinetry with detailed carvings and rich, dark woods.

Modern architectural styles, with their focus on uncluttered lines and minimalism, transform into sleek Custom Woodwork Cabinetry designs showcasing flush doors and integrated hardware, often concealing drawer and drawers for a streamlined look. Farmhouse custom wooden cabinets woodwork cabinets prioritize functionality and a rustic allure, often exhibiting shaker-style custom wooden cabinets with practical storage solutions.
